Output 981baabcd83a9d22788c28bb08b3b8276a7df2124a21db732581e808e13c8d45:1

value
1286525000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c66cfb40388f4330564031f3a1ef21e665d07f2 OP_EQUALVERIFY OP_CHECKSIG
address
DDZfsN4nopBky12Fm7yjzsWK56VDtaj3Dg
transaction
981baabcd83a9d22788c28bb08b3b8276a7df2124a21db732581e808e13c8d45